WebDespite the fact that conventional fabrication approaches such as lithography, imprinting and soft lithography have been widely used for the preparation of microfluidic chips, it … WebMicrofluidic chip fabrication techniques: polymer casting. The last way to make a microfluidic device is to create a mold and use polymer to replicate it. There are different ways to make the mold but the principle is always the same. You need to create the negative of your design with a hard material and then pour a liquid polymer on it.
